[android] 광고 제거 옵션과 영향

안드로이드 앱을 개발하는 동안 광고 제거 옵션을 구현하는 것이 매우 중요합니다. 사용자 경험을 향상시키고 앱의 인기도를 높일 수 있기 때문입니다. 하지만 광고 제거 옵션을 구현하면 수익에도 영향을 줄 수 있으므로 신중히 검토해야 합니다.

광고 제거 옵션 구현하기

안드로이드 앱에서 광고 제거 옵션을 구현하려면 사용자가 구매한 프리미엄 버전의 앱을 설치한 것인지 여부를 확인해야 합니다. 이를 위해 Firebase나 Google Play Billing Library 등의 도구를 사용하여 사용자의 구매 여부를 확인할 수 있습니다. 사용자가 프리미엄 버전을 구매했을 경우에는 앱 내에서 광고를 제거하도록 처리합니다.

// 광고 제거 옵션 확인
if (isPremiumUser()) {
    // 광고 제거
    removeAds();
}

영향 분석

광고 제거 옵션을 구현한 후에는 사용자 경험이 개선될 수 있습니다. 광고가 제거되면 앱을 사용하는데 집중할 수 있게 되므로 사용자들이 만족할 확률이 높아집니다. 따라서 앱의 인기도가 상승할 수 있습니다.

그러나 반대로 수익에는 부정적인 영향을 줄 수 있습니다. 광고가 제거되면서 광고 수익이 감소할 수 있고, 프리미엄 버전을 구매한 사용자들도 있을 것이므로 이들의 수익도 감소할 수 있습니다.

마무리

광고 제거 옵션을 구현하여 사용자의 경험을 향상시킬 수 있지만, 수익에는 영향을 줄 수 있음을 고려해야 합니다. 사용자의 만족도와 수익을 고려하여 광고 제거 옵션을 선택하는 것이 중요합니다.

Firebase 공식 문서Google Play Billing Library 공식 문서를 참고하여 앱에 광고 제거 옵션을 구현하고 영향을 분석해보세요.